The Semperoper Dresden has appointed the Sächsischer Kammersänger (Saxon Chamber Singer) Hans-Joachim Ketelsen as its Honorary Member. After the performance of »La bohème« on Friday, 3 February 2023, in which the baritone will perform the role of Benoît, the new titleholder will receive an official certificate from the intendant of Saxon State Opera.

The American Symphony Orchestra continues its 2022-23 season on January 27 with a program at St. Bartholomew's Church, a New York National Historic Landmark, exploring music for organ and orchestra by Camille Saint-Saëns and Dame Ethel Smyth. It features soloist Paolo Bordignon, organist and choirmaster of the church and harpsichordist of the New York Philharmonic, along with soprano Anya Matanovic, mezzo-soprano Eve Gigliotti, tenor Joshua Blue, and bass Adam Lau.
Following a successful collaboration during London Art Week and the first four concerts of the residency from September to November 2022, the Philharmonia and Cromwell Place have announced the programme for the second half of the residency from January - June 2023. Members of the Philharmonia have formed ensembles and selected music to reflect the themes of the changing exhibitions at Cromwell Place.
